Crypto payment firms sit near the top of the target list for advanced persistent threat groups, and the workload on their security leaders keeps growing. Malcolm Portelli, CISO at Coinflow, runs the company’s security program from Malta. Coinflow is headquartered in the United States and operates across multiple jurisdictions. Portelli sat down for this interview at the Span Cyber Security Arena conference.

Portelli says the sector drives his threat model more than the location. “It’s more the industry which we operate in. So, financial services, Web3, and crypto and all that comes with that.
